PEPE questions, answered with data

What are the most common problems with the Benelli PEPE?

Across 216 UK examples, the most frequently recorded MOT faults are lights and indicators (19.7% of all recorded faults), suspension (12.9% of all recorded faults), brakes (9.2% of all recorded faults).

What is average mileage for a Benelli PEPE?

The median Benelli PEPE in the UK has covered 4,974 miles, and typically rides about 619 miles a year. Half of all examples fall between 2,292 and 8,582 miles.

Is the Benelli PEPE reliable?

76.15% of Benelli PEPE MOT tests are passed first time, with an average of 0.8 faults recorded per test. This is measured from DVSA MOT records, not owner opinion.
